From Azzurri Blue to Maple Leaf Red: Canada Courts Italian Soccer Fans

Canada Soccer playfully extended an invitation to Italy's disheartened World Cup fans, encouraging them to swap their iconic Azzurri jerseys for Canada's maple leaf red. The gesture followed Italy's latest failure to qualify after their defeat to Bosnia, prompting resignations in their soccer federation.

Seizing the moment, Canada, set to co-host the 2026 World Cup, urged Italian supporters to embrace a new alliance. The outreach was centered at Cafe Diplomatico in Toronto's Little Italy, a strategic location chosen for its popularity among Italian-Canadians.

While the jersey swap was largely symbolic, the move saw a warm reception, with hundreds participating. Canada Soccer distributed 2026 shirts and posters, fostering World Cup excitement without any jersey returns.
